UPDATED: Sheriff's Deputies Shoot Reckless DUI Driver at End of Pursuit in Cerritos

The wounded suspect was taken to a hospital where he is listed in stable condition.

A reckless motorist who was allegedly driving under the influence was shot and wounded by a Lakewood Sheriff's Station deputies at the end of a pursuit in Cerritos Sunday night, authorities said.

The shooting took place near Judy Way and Cuesta Drive about 7:30 p.m. Feb. 26, said Deputy Tony Moore of the Sheriff's Headquarters Bureau. The shooting appears to have occurred in a residential area close to the office and the .

Moore said at least one sheriff's deputy shot and wounded the male suspect, who was described as a Hispanic man.

"It was at the end of a reckless driver pursuit -- a DUI suspect,'' Moore said, adding that it was unclear whether the suspect fired at the deputies.

The suspect was taken to a hospital, where he is listed in stable condition, according to the Sheriff's Headquarters Bureau. No deputies were hit, Moore added.

Details on what triggered the chase were not immediately released.

The roadways into the residential area from Cuesta Drive and along 166th Street were blocked for several hours as sheriff's personnel conducted their investigation, leaving many residents without access to their homes until just before midnight.

When a deputy-involved shooting occurs, multiple investigations immediately begin at the scene of the shooting. These include separate investigations by the Sheriff's Internal Affairs Bureau as well as Sheriff's Station or Detective Division investigators. Attorneys with the Los Angeles Office of Independent Review also respond to the scene, and have full access to the facts known to the sheriff's department throughout every phase of these investigations. Once concluded, every aspect of the shooting is reviewed by the Sheriff's Executive Force Review Committee. -- LASD Sheriff's Headquarters Bureau
